Karsten Fundal's Entropia for Large Orchestra, Soprano and Baritone soli, Large Choir and Chamber Choir (SATB) and prerecorded sound (1997-2001).
Commissioned by the Danish National SymphonyOrchestra and Choir / DR.
About Entropia:
This orchestral work is chiefly an attempt to make a musical investigation into the complex question of the nature oftime. The viewpoint taken, on a philosophical level, is chiefly inspired by the brilliant thinker and philosopher of time, J. F. Fraser. The main conclusion of his investigation of the subject, is, in very short, that theonlyadequate view to take of time as a phenomenon, with all the knowledge that we have today, is that time must be seen as a conflict or at least an interference, between many different 'temporal levels' (...)
